Two short clips, posted anonymously in 2014, show an airliner over open ocean with three glowing objects holding station around it in a rotating triangle. The objects converge, there is a flash, and the aircraft is no longer in frame. This site treats that footage as the observation that sent Ashton Forbes into the physics, and never as proof of it — the physics on these pages rests on Casimir measurements, the dynamical Casimir effect, lattice confinement fusion and thirty years of published propulsion literature, none of which depends on any video. What the clips do supply is a picture worth reading carefully: a three-source geometry, an object that glows brightly while reading cool on an infrared sensor, and a departure with no acceleration signature. Forbes’s own reading, in his 13 July 2026 analysis, is that the aircraft never travelled at all — the distance did. Provenance is genuinely open, published analyses trace the clips to an anonymous creator, and the two tests that would settle it are named below.

- 0:07:09Forbes reaches for the negative-time photon experiments and argues that changing the permittivity of spacetime should let matter tunnel through the light barrier. The durable half of that idea is the medium itself: the speed of light is one over the square root of permittivity times permeability, so it is a property of space rather than of light. The negative-time result is a negative group delay in a dispersive medium, and the leading edge of any signal still travels at c — which is why this site makes the metric claim and not the superluminal one.

Two short videos — one visible-light, one infrared — appeared anonymously on YouTube on 19 May 2014 and are attributed to the account RegicideAnon. The Skeptical Inquirer analysis of February 2024 and Metabunk thread 13104 trace them to that anonymous creator and match the cloud layer to commercial stock HD cloud textures; no original sensor files with intact metadata have been produced.
